If a bitmap exists for a shadow set
member, a minicopy operation starts by default when you specify the
MOUNT command to return a shadow set member to the shadow set. This
is equivalent to using the /POLICY=MINICOPY=OPTIONAL qualifier to
the MOUNT command. If a bitmap is not available, a full copy occurs.
An example of using the /POLICY=MINICOPY=OPTIONAL
qualifier with the MOUNT command follows:
$ MOUNT DSA5/SHAD=$4$DUA0/POLICY=MINICOPY=OPTIONAL volume-label
|
If the shadow set (DSA5) is already mounted and
a bitmap exists for this shadow set member ($4$DUA0), the command
adds the device $4$DUA0 to the shadow set with a minicopy operation.
If a bitmap is not available, this command adds $4$DUA0 with a full
copy.
To ensure that a MOUNT command succeeds only if
a minicopy can take place, specify /POLICY=MINICOPY only (that is,
omit =OPTIONAL). If a bitmap is not available, the mount fails.
